phpbar.de logo

Mailinglisten-Archive

=?iso-8859-1?Q?Re:_PHP_verk=FCrzt_BLOB_eintr=E4ge?=

Re: PHP verkürzt BLOB einträge

Andreas Langen LA-X(TM) mysql_(at)_lists.phpcenter.de
Sun, 7 Oct 2001 18:40:58 +0200


> Müsste das nicht fread(fopen($form_data, "rb")); heissen. b für binary,
hat
> bei mir einmal geholfen...

"fread" list eine Datei binär und "fgets" list Zeilenweise aus...
Aber das "b" kann man weglassen.

"....Zusätzlich kann mode der Buchstabe 'b' hinzugefügt werden, der die
Behandlung von Binär-Dateien erlaubt. Dieses ist sinnvoll auf Systemen,
welche zwischen Binär- und Text-Dateien unterscheiden. Wenn das Feature
nicht gebraucht wird, wird es einfach ignoriert....."

Den "addslashes Befehl" braucht man auch nicht. Wozu slashes hinzufügen?
Einfach auslesen und abspeichern. Wenn man denn das Zeug in der DB haben
muss.....
Wir haben das Problem ja schon x-mal in der Liste gehabt. Du müllst Dir
damit unter Umständen schnell den Server zu....

// liest den Inhalt einer Datei in einen String
$filename = "/usr/local/simi.txt";
$fd = fopen ($filename, "r");
$contents = fread ($fd, filesize ($filename));
fclose ($fd);

Bis dann Andreas Langen

---
!!NEU!!
Fragen und Antworten zu MySQL und dieser Liste unter
-->>  http://www.4t2.com/mysql 



php::bar PHP Wiki   -   Listenarchive